Why Nations Fail was a book I was very excited to read. However, it did take me quite some time to finish this book. There are many pages that are interesting, share insight of fascinating cities from different parts of the world. Yet it felt like more focus was on Europe and to some extent the Americas. Frankly, that felt very far away from Nepal. I couldn’t help but read the pages wondering where Nepal’s progress fits in all these theories. There are some simple and logical theories about what type of institutions help progress; help the development of a country. Still, the book could’ve been a lot leaner as 479 pages was very long. I believe the authors could make their point, give enough examples from contrasting parts of the world and tested different theories in a leaner book.
